Product Introduction

**SFS4416-VB** is a power MOSFET with a single N-channel structure in a SOP8 package. The maximum drain-source voltage (VDS) of the device is 30V, which is suitable for low-voltage applications. Its gate-source voltage (VGS) operating range is ±20V, and it has a low threshold voltage (Vth) of 1.7V, ensuring high performance under low-voltage driving conditions. The product has an extremely low on-resistance (RDS(ON)), which is 11mΩ at VGS=4.5V and 8mΩ at VGS=10V, ensuring low power consumption and efficient transmission. The maximum drain current (ID) is 13A, which is suitable for medium-power switching applications. SFS4416-VB uses Trench technology and has excellent switching characteristics. It is suitable for power management, battery-powered equipment, and high-efficiency power conversion systems.

Detailed parameter description

- **Model**: SFS4416-VB
- **Package type**: SOP8
- **Configuration**: Single-N-Channel
- **Maximum drain-source voltage (VDS)**: 30V
- **Maximum gate-source voltage (VGS)**: ±20V
- **Threshold voltage (Vth)**: 1.7V
- **On-resistance (RDS(ON))**:
- 11mΩ (VGS = 4.5V)
- 8mΩ (VGS = 10V)
- **Maximum drain current (ID)**: 13A
- **Technology**: Trench

Application fields and module examples

1. **Power management system**
In power management systems, the SFS4416-VB can be used as a switching element for DC-DC converters due to its low on-resistance and high current carrying capacity. Its low Vth characteristics enable it to start and operate stably at a lower voltage, making it very suitable for efficient power conversion. Especially in portable devices and mobile power modules, the SFS4416-VB can effectively reduce power consumption and improve system efficiency.

2. **Battery-driven devices**
In battery-driven devices such as portable electronic products (mobile phones, laptops, etc.), the SFS4416-VB can optimize the efficiency of battery power usage. Its low on-resistance and low Vth enable more efficient battery management and power regulation, extending the battery life of the device.

3. **Electric Vehicles (EV) and Battery Management Systems (BMS)**
In EVs and BMSs, the SFS4416-VB can be used in battery voltage regulation, current control, and charge and discharge management modules. Its low on-resistance and high current handling capability enable it to maintain low losses under high-frequency switching operations, improving the energy efficiency of the battery system.

4. **Power Amplifier and Radio Frequency (RF) Applications**
The low Vth and high-frequency response characteristics of the SFS4416-VB also make it suitable for use in RF power amplifiers. This MOSFET can maintain low conduction losses in high-frequency signal processing, improve signal processing efficiency, and is widely used in wireless communications and other RF modules.
